FAQs
1. What is the average rent in Crane?
Rental prices in Crane generally range from $800 to $1,200 per month, depending on the size and location of the property.
2. Are there good job opportunities in Crane?
Crane has a variety of job opportunities, especially in the oil and gas industry, which is a significant employer in the region.
3. How do property taxes compare in Crane?
Property taxes in Crane are moderate, and the rates are competitive compared to other areas in Texas.
4. Is it cheaper to buy or rent in Crane?
Generally, purchasing a home is often more economical in the long run compared to renting, especially given the current market conditions.
5. What are the typical utility costs?
Monthly utility costs for an average household in Crane can vary but typically fall between $150 and $250, depending on usage.
